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1223217 48359071609 49779557 5475490591 266
71569244 073529
71569244 073529
633113 09634563655 550226
All about undefined
Interested in learning more?
71569244 073529
633113 09634563655 550226
See more
54679729 19261 4549063572
17 94598 49
See more
83716620195 366098819 13995
62 3118 3709664721 54795540
See more